Wrap-free multi-wavelength phase retrieval based on the projected refractive index framework

Abstract

We introduce an efficient and robust algorithmic framework f or multi-wavelength phase retrieval that directly recovers the absolute phase, obviating the need of phase-unwrapping steps which are computationally expensive and sensitive to noise.
